Partner turn signal lamp error

I'm having trouble with my 2007 Peugeot Partner diesel. The turn signal lamp is acting up. I keep getting an error stored in the error memory, and an error message pops up on the speedometer. It's definitely a fault in the lighting somewhere. I've checked the bulb itself, and it looks fine. Any ideas?

I had a similar issue with my Partner. It might be a defective cable or plug connection. Check the wiring harness near the light assembly. I remember having to wiggle mine around to get the light to work temporarily. Is the lens broken or cracked?

I took it to the workshop, and you were spot on. It was indeed a faulty connection in the wiring harness. They replaced the connector, and everything's working perfectly now. Cost me 95€, but at least it's fixed!
